DESCRIPTION

A presentation by Geof Huth explaining the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ist (DAS) Curriculum and Program at the E-Records Forum in Austin, Texas, on 25 April 2012. The presentation explains the genesis of DAS, how it operates, and the benefits to potential DAS candidates.

Page 4: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

May 2010◦ Council created Digital Archives Continuing Education TF

◦ Charged with creating detailed digital archives curriculum

Fall and Winter 2010-2012◦ Met in person In Chicago and via conference calls

February 2011◦ DACE provided Education Committee an initial report

March 2011◦ Draft distributed to SAA sections and roundtables

April-May 2011◦ DACE and Education Committee revised report 

24-26 May 2011◦ SAA Council accepted DAS Curriculum & Certificate Program

How DAS Came to Be

Page 12: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

1. Foundational Courses

◦ Essential skills

◦ Focus on practitioners

◦ Information to implement in the next year

2. Tactical and Strategic Courses

◦ Skills to make significant changes in organizations

◦ Focus on managers

◦ Information to implement in the next five years

Four Tiers of Study (1 & 2)

Page 13: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

3. Tools and Services Courses

◦ Focus on tools and services for digital archives

◦ Focus on practitioners

◦ Information to implement immediately

4. Transformational Courses

◦ Skills to transform institutions into digital archives

◦ Focus on administrators

◦ Information to implement over the next ten years

Four Tiers of Study (3 & 4)

Page 19: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

Take an assessment quiz before registering

◦ To determine if you need the training

◦ If not, don’t take that training

◦ Take only the test

These quizzes are not yet ready

◦ DAS Continuing Education is finalizing

◦ Will be ready in late spring

Assessment Quizzes

Page 20: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

Option 1: Course + Exam◦ Take a ½-day, 1-day, or 2-day course

◦ Take and pass exam within a week

Option 2: Exam◦ Pay a small fee and test out

Option 3: Webinar + Exam◦ Take a 90-minute webinar

◦ Take and pass exam within a week

◦ Additional attendees need to purchase the exam

Three Ways towards Course Credit

Page 21: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

Within 24 months…

◦ Attend the nine required courses

◦ Pass each course with score of 85% or better

Some may test out of Foundational courses

Pass a comprehensive examination

◦ Within the same 24-month period

Renew certificate every five years

Completing DAS Successfully

Page 22: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

Exam will test all core competencies

Much longer that the post-course tests

Requires broad knowledge from candidates

Will be offered at various locations across US

First offered in early 2013

The Comprehensive Exam

Page 23: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

Fees vary Fees for members are cheaper

◦ $95 for ½-day

◦ $185 for 1-day

◦ $299 for 2-day 

Package discount◦ 7 courses and exams at the regular rate

◦ And receive 2 free courses and exams 

◦ For $1,265 total, saving $341

Costs

Page 27: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

Structure of Exams

◦ Multiple-choice questions

◦ Completed online

◦ Can navigate the exam and change answers

If you fail an exam…

◦ Take it again within two weeks

If you fail the same exam again…

◦ Take course and exam again at discounted rate

Course Exam Details

Page 28: Society of American Archivists' Digital Archives Specialist Program

Webinars◦ 10 questions and 1 hour to complete

 Half-day Courses  ◦ 15 questions and 90 minutes to complete

 One-day Courses◦ 20 questions and 2 hours to complete

Two-day Courses◦ 30 questions and 4 hours to complete

Passing grade is 85%

Exam Rules
